      Technical Specifications (Configurable):

      FeatureDescription
      Power Range0.5 HP to 500 HP+ (0.37 kW to 370 kW+)
      Input Voltage208V, 230V, 400V, 480V, 575V, 690V (3-Phase)
      Output VoltageMatches Input Voltage
      VFD ManufacturerSiemens, Allen-Bradley, Schneider Electric, Danfoss, ABB, Yaskawa, Delta, Parker, etc. (client choice)
      Enclosure TypeNEMA 12 (Indoor, Dust-tight), NEMA 4 (Indoor/Outdoor, Watertight), NEMA 4X (Corrosion Resistant, Stainless Steel/Fiberglass)
      Control Voltage120V AC, 24V DC (Standard, configurable)
      Standard ComponentsMain Disconnect Switch (Fused/Non-Fused), Circuit Breaker, VFD, Control Relays, Terminal Blocks, Cooling Fan (as needed), Filters
      Optional ComponentsEMI/RFI Filters, Braking Resistors, Line/Load Reactors, DV/DT Filters, Harmonic Filters, PLC, HMI, Remote I/O, Bypass Contactors, Pilot Lights, Selector Switches, Pushbuttons, E-Stop, Surge Protection, Space Heater, Air Conditioner, Ventilation Fans, Door Interlocks
      CommunicationModbus RTU, Ethernet/IP, Profibus, Profinet, DeviceNet, BACnet, CANopen (VFD dependent)
      Operating Temp.-10°C to +40°C (14°F to 104°F) - extended range with HVAC options
      CertificationsUL 508A, CE, CSA, IEC (as required)
      DocumentationComplete Wiring Schematics, Bill of Materials, O&M Manuals

      Typical Applications:

      Our VFD Control Panels are ideal for a multitude of industries and applications, including:

      • Pumps: Centrifugal, positive displacement, submersible, and booster pumps for flow control, pressure regulation, and level control in water/wastewater, HVAC, and industrial processes.
      • Fans & Blowers: HVAC systems, industrial ventilation, air handling units, cooling towers, and dust collection systems for optimized airflow and energy savings.
      • Conveyors: Smooth start/stop and precise speed adjustments for material handling systems, preventing product damage and reducing wear.
      • Mixers & Agitators: Accurate speed control for chemical, food & beverage, and pharmaceutical processes, ensuring product consistency.
      • Extruders & Winders: Consistent speed and tension control for plastics, textiles, and paper industries.
      • Machine Tools: Enhanced precision, reduced wear, and operational efficiency for drilling, milling, grinding, and turning machines.
      • Water & Wastewater Treatment: Optimized pump and blower operation, reduced surge effects, and energy conservation.
      • Food & Beverage Processing: Hygienic and precise control for various processing machinery, bottling lines, and packaging equipment.
      • General Manufacturing: Any application requiring variable speed control for AC motors.
